Advanced Injection Molding Technology & Material Science

Producing durable plastic mould boxes capable of withstanding industrial environments requires advanced engineering and precise manufacturing processes. The journey begins with mold design, where engineers utilize state-of-the-art CAD/CAM/CAE software to simulate plastic flow, optimize cooling cycles, and predict potential warping. High-grade tool steel is meticulously machined using multi-axis CNC centers, electrical discharge machining (EDM), and precision grinding to guarantee that the final mold can endure millions of cycles.

Material selection is equally critical. For industrial-grade plastic boxes, High-Density Polyethylene (HDPE) and Polypropylene (PP) are the materials of choice:

  • High-Density Polyethylene (HDPE): Renowned for its exceptional impact strength, chemical resistance, and performance in low-temperature environments—ideal for food logistics and cold chain storage.
  • Polypropylene (PP): Offers superior structural rigidity, high flexural fatigue resistance, and excellent heat resistance, making it perfect for heavy parts storage and stackable warehouse crates.
  • Electrostatic Discharge (ESD) Additives: Essential for electronics manufacturing, preventing static buildup that could destroy sensitive microchips during transit.

Localized Application Scenarios in HCMC's Key Sectors

Plastic mould boxes are highly versatile products, customized to serve the unique operational requirements of various industries in Southern Vietnam:

1. Electronics and Semiconductor Assembly

In Saigon Hi-Tech Park (SHTP), electronic component manufacturers require specialized ESD-safe plastic boxes. These boxes prevent static charges from damaging microprocessors, circuit boards, and other sensitive semiconductors. They are designed with precise internal configurations and partition slots to keep delicate parts isolated and secure during intra-factory transport.

2. Agriculture and Aquaculture Logistics

As the main gateway for agricultural products from the Mekong Delta, Ho Chi Minh City handles massive volumes of fruits, vegetables, and seafood for export. Perforated plastic crates are essential in this sector, allowing ventilation to maintain freshness and prevent spoilage. They are designed to withstand high humidity and cold storage temperatures in refrigerated shipping containers.

3. E-Commerce and Smart Warehousing

With the rapid rise of digital platforms like Shopee, Lazada, and Tiki, logistics centers are modernizing with automated storage and retrieval systems (ASRS). These systems require highly standardized, flat-bottomed plastic boxes with integrated barcode or RFID tracking slots to ensure seamless compatibility with automated conveyors and robotic pickers.

4. Automotive and Heavy Machinery

Automotive assembly plants in neighboring Binh Duong and Dong Nai rely on reinforced plastic boxes to store and transport heavy steel parts, fasteners, and interior components. These crates are engineered to handle high load capacities and can be securely stacked to optimize floor space in busy assembly plants.

Future Trends: Circular Economy & Smart Packaging in Vietnam

As Southern Vietnam solidifies its position as a global manufacturing powerhouse, the plastic packaging and material handling industries are undergoing rapid evolution. One of the most significant trends is the shift toward sustainability and circular economy models. Factories in Ho Chi Minh City are increasingly adopting recycled resins (PCR) and biodegradable polymers to reduce their environmental impact. Modern plastic mould box manufacturers are designing lighter yet stronger structures, utilizing advanced finite element analysis (FEA) to reduce raw material consumption while maintaining load-bearing performance.

Furthermore, the integration of smart logistics features is redefining the utility of plastic crates. Modern warehouse setups feature IoT tracking systems, where plastic boxes are embedded with RFID tags or QR codes. This allows logistics personnel to track inventory in real-time, monitor temperature levels for sensitive agricultural exports, and optimize route efficiency.
